    hahaha this post made me laugh :D we get it back to the tree by picking it up and putting it there lol we used to play with them when we were little kids, make them hiss and stick them on each others shirts cos they have good grip. they are tonnes of fun.

    they are a hard shelled beetle and they hiss. As you can see she knows to be cautious of the front of it due to the pincer (but its not that harmful if it was to get her). they are pretty hardy little beetles.

    There are now DNA tests available that can pinpoint what your dog might be genetically. Some companies can only do 30 or so breeds but most advertise well over 150. Why should you care - well it is a way to know what sorts of things healthwise you should be on the lookout for as many breeds have unique health issues. I was at the vet last year and there was a puggle there with an eye issue - the owners shared what it was and it is common in beagles. They then went on to say that they had trouble with the other eye before and it was an issues specific (although not exclusive) to pugs. So much for hybrid vigor. Darling picture though - good luck
